Output d3e6798226e174a98d46ffc3396fda2acb4a5165d6d966c804a5a94a490f21bc:57

value
443043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 618dab7ee77d50ccc917c969df3f2bd60b2c9f14 OP_EQUAL
address
3AaqBYngwLuNqcRsLZF9MP2j43prtPLfx9
transaction
d3e6798226e174a98d46ffc3396fda2acb4a5165d6d966c804a5a94a490f21bc